Date:Saturday 18 February 1950
Time:
Type:Silhouette image of generic ERCO model; specific model in this crash may look slightly different    
ERCO 415-C Ercoupe
Owner/operator:Private
Registration: N80371
MSN: 3815
Fatalities:Fatalities: 0 / Occupants: 1
Aircraft damage: Destroyed
Location:Near San Diego, CA -   United States of America
Phase: En route
Nature:Private
Departure airport:Burbank, CA
Destination airport:San Diego, CA
Narrative:
Crashed into a hill after getting lost in fog and running out of fuel.
